picit 09-28-2007 09:08 PM

RE: INDIANA hunters
 
I work at a gun shop in Kokomo and have sold quite a few .500 Handi rifles....I say use the 20ga!! Most guys arent getting the groups they want and it kicks like a mule!! You can get about 150 yards with the Hornady 300grn sst bullets but your 20ga will do the same. You may want to look into Hastings slugs for it. I had one and shot lightfields also and it was a tack driver!! Dont waste your money unless you just want something new!
